The cost of pool site leveling in Bainbridge Island, WA, can vary significantly based on several factors. Site leveling is a crucial step in pool installation, ensuring a stable and even foundation for your pool. Understanding the elements that influence the cost can help you budget more effectively for your pool project.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Type: Different soil types require varying levels of preparation and stabilization.
- Slope of Land: Steeper slopes often need more extensive leveling work.
- Size of Pool Area: Larger areas generally incur higher costs due to the increased amount of work needed.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ach sites may require specialized equipment, increasing costs.
- Permits and Regulations: Local regulations and necessary permits can add to the overall expense.
- Labor Costs: The cost of labor can vary depending on the expertise required and local rates.
- Equipment Rental: The need for specialized machinery can also impact the total c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ost |
---|---|
Site Survey | $300 - $500 |
Soil Testing | $200 - $400 |
Basic Site Leveling |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Excavation |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Slope Stabilization | $1,500 - $4,000 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
Equipment Rental | $500 - $1,500 |
Labor (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
